Methane Global Tracker Report

  • The International Energy Agency (IEA) publishes the Methane Global Tracker Report every year.
  • Since 1993, the International Energy Agency (IEA) has used this large-scale simulation model to generate detailed sector-by-sector and region-by-region projections for the World Energy Outlook (WEO) scenarios.
  • For the first time, the 2022 report provides a comprehensive collection of country-level figures for methane emissions from the energy industry.
  • The Tracker is an essential tool in the battle to reduce pollution and the new Global Methane Pledge.
  • Methane is responsible for roughly 30% of the increase in global temps since the Industrial Revolution, and reducing methane emissions quickly and sustainably is critical to controlling near-term global warming and improving air quality.

Methane Global Tracker Report - Key Findings

  • The energy industry, which includes oil, natural gas, coal, and biomass, accounts for roughly 40% of anthropogenic methane emissions.
  • According to the Report, there is a huge disparity in emissions data, with the real quantity being roughly 70% higher than what national governments have formally recorded.
  • In 2022, the worldwide energy industry was responsible for approximately 135 million tonnes of methane emissions.
  • The incomplete combustion of bioenergy, primarily from the conventional use of wood, added approximately 10 Mt of emissions.
  • During the digging, extraction, and shipping processes, as well as when natural gas is flared or expelled, methane is released into the atmosphere.
  • Every year, more than 260 billion cubic metres of natural gas (mostly methane) are lost due to flaring and methane escapes around the world.
  • According to the study, the fossil fuel sector could adopt 80% of the available choices to reduce methane emissions at no expense.
  • Finally, reducing 75% of natural gas waste could reduce global temperature increase by nearly 0.1 degree Celsius by mid-century, having the same effect as instantly cutting greenhouse gas emissions from vehicles globally.

Global Methane Pledge

  • The Global Methane Pledge was introduced in November 2021, and yearly ministerial-level talks are held to assess progress.
  • This promise aims to galvanise international action and increase global support for current methane emission reduction efforts.
  • Its goal is to progress technological and legislative work to support participants' domestic activities.
  • It has over 100 members, accounting for nearly half of global man made methane emissions and more than two-thirds of global GDP.
  • It is on track to meet the Pledge target of averting more than 8 gigatonnes of CO2 equivalent emissions per year by 2030.
  • MARS is an acronym for Methane Alert and Response System. It incorporates statistics on methane leaks. The United Nations Environment Programme initiated it. It's a satellite-based surveillance system.

Steps taken by India to control Methane Emissions

  • The Paris Agreement: India is a signatory to the agreement, which seeks to keep global warming to less than 2°C and to continue measures to keep temperature increases to less than 1.5°C.
  • National Action Plan on Climate Change (NAPCC): Its particular goal is to decrease agricultural emissions by promoting low-emission agricultural technologies and practices, such as the use of organic fertilisers and improved livestock management.
  • Renewable energy: The government has also introduced several schemes to encourage the use of renewable energy sources, such as solar and wind power, which can help decrease reliance on fossil fuels and related methane emissions.
  • National Green Tribunal: It has the authority to hear environmental cases and implement environmental laws, including those governing methane emissions.
  • National Clean Energy Fund: The Ministry of Environment, Forestry, and Climate Change established the National Clean Energy Fund to fund study and development of clean energy technologies and initiatives.

FAQs

Question: What is the Methane Global Tracker Report?

Answer: The Methane Global Tracker Report is a global initiative that tracks methane emissions from various sectors, including oil and gas, agriculture, and waste management. It provides insights into the sources, trends, and impacts of methane emissions, aiming to guide global efforts to reduce this potent greenhouse gas.

Question: Why is methane considered a significant greenhouse gas?

Answer: Methane is a significant greenhouse gas because it has a global warming potential much higher than carbon dioxide. It traps heat in the atmosphere, contributing to climate change. Although methane remains in the atmosphere for a shorter time than CO2, its impact is far more intense in the short term.

Question: What are the main sources of methane emissions?

Answer: The primary sources of methane emissions include agriculture (especially livestock and rice paddies), fossil fuel extraction (oil and gas), waste management (landfills), and biomass burning. These sectors release methane into the atmosphere during various stages of production and consumption.

Question: How does the Methane Global Tracker Report contribute to climate change mitigation?

Answer: The Methane Global Tracker Report provides data and analysis on methane emissions, helping policymakers, industries, and environmental organizations identify major sources and regions of concern. It promotes targeted mitigation strategies, such as improved monitoring, regulations, and technological innovations, to reduce methane emissions and combat climate change.

Question: What are the key findings of the Methane Global Tracker Report?

Answer: Key findings from the Methane Global Tracker Report highlight the urgency of reducing methane emissions, particularly in the oil and gas sector, where large amounts are flared or vented. The report stresses the need for better monitoring, increased regulatory action, and the adoption of methane capture technologies to significantly reduce global emissions.
